The Importance of the Manual Transmission

While automatic transmissions have become more prevalent in recent years, manual transmissions still have a special place in the hearts of car enthusiasts. They offer a more engaging driving experience and give the driver more control over the vehicle. Manual transmissions are also generally more affordable and easier to maintain, making them a practical choice for those looking for a reliable car.
